How does a virtual mental health IOP operate?

A virtual mental health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P) offers individuals a flexible yet structured approach to mental health treatment. Instead of traveling to a physical facility, participants engage in therapy, counseling, and skill-building sessions through secure online platforms. Can a virtual mental health IOP help with anxiety and depression?

Understanding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OPs)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OPs) are structured mental health treatment services delivered entirely online. Designed to support individuals with moderate mental health needs, IOPs typically offer a higher level of care than standard outpatient therapy but are less restrictive than inpatient programs.
